A block of mass m m is kept over another block of mass M M and the system rests on a horizontal surface as shown in the figure. A constant horizontal force F F acting on the lower block produces an acceleration of F 2 ( m + M ) \frac F2(m+M) in the system, the 2 blocks always move together. Find the coefficient of kinetic friction b/w the bigger block and horizontal surface.

F/(m+M)g Fg/2(m+M) F/2(m+M)g F/2(m+M)
